Common English Proverbs for Expressing Efficiency
Here are some classic English proverbs that can be used to convey efficiency in various contexts:
1. "Time is money."
This proverb underscores the importance of valuing time as a precious resource. It's often used to encourage people to prioritize tasks and manage their time effectively. For example, "I can't afford to waste time on trivial matters; time is money, after all."
2. "Less is more."
This proverb suggests that sometimes simplicity is the key to effectiveness. It's particularly useful in creative fields, where it reminds us to avoid overcomplicating things. For instance, "The designer chose a minimalist approach, which, as they say, 'less is more' and the design turned out beautifully simple."
3. "Brevity is the soul of wit."
This proverb is often attributed to William Shakespeare and emphasizes the power of being concise. It's a great reminder to get to the point without losing the essence of your message. For example, "In the meeting, she made her point succinctly, showing that 'brevity is the soul of wit' indeed."
Proverbs for Time Management and Productivity
Time management is crucial for efficiency, and there are several proverbs that can help emphasize this concept:
4. "Make hay while the sun shines."
This proverb encourages taking advantage of favorable conditions while they last. It's often used to advise people to be productive during times of opportunity. For example, "We need to make hay while the sun shines and complete this project before the funding runs out."
5. "A stitch in time saves nine."
This proverb highlights the wisdom of dealing with small problems before they become bigger, more complex issues. It's a great reminder to take prompt action. For example, "By addressing the software bug early, we saved a lot of trouble in the long run, just as 'a stitch in time saves nine'."
6. "Strike while the iron is hot."
This proverb suggests that the best time to act on an opportunity is when you're at your most motivated or when conditions are most favorable. For example, "The team should strike while the iron is hot and finalize the deal before the competition catches up."
Proverbs for Conveying Impact and Clarity
When you want to make a strong point or ensure your message is understood, these proverbs can be quite effective:
7. "A picture is worth a thousand words."
This proverb emphasizes the power of visual communication. It's often used to justify the use of imagery or diagrams to convey complex information. For example, "The chart clearly illustrates the data, proving that 'a picture is worth a thousand words'."
8. "The proof of the pudding is in the eating."
This proverb suggests that the best way to judge something is to experience it firsthand. It's often used to encourage practical testing or demonstration. For example, "Before we commit to the new system, we should try it out to see if it really does live up to the hype, as the old saying goes, 'the proof of the pudding is in the eating'."
9. "Actions speak louder than words."
This proverb underscores the value of actions over mere talk. It's a powerful reminder that what you do can often have more impact than what you say. For example, "Instead of just promising to help, he rolled up his sleeves and got to work, proving that 'actions speak louder than words'."
